How to Find House Numbers by Street Names in California

Unlike many communities that define neighborhoods by street, California organizes house numbers (addresses) by the block. As you drive along a street, the blocks are the areas between the cross streets. Californians measure distances in terms of blocks. House numbers go in order, with odd numbers on one side of the street and even numbers on the other. Each block has a hundred possible addresses, but doesn't usually use them all. Some street name signs have numbers that indicate the range of addresses on that block.

Instructions

    • 1

      Compare the address you seek against the house block number on the street name sign. If your address is higher, then go the direction of the arrow. Go the other way if it is lower. If there is no arrow, then try one way until the house numbers get larger or smaller.

    • 2

      Subtract your house number from the house block number on the street name sign. Divide the result by 100.

    • 3

      Travel that number of blocks, and you will find your house number.
